Take a look at our past work!

ECC Roofing & Siding

ECC Roofing & Siding offers comprehensive roofing and siding services that will give you the protection you need and the style you want. We have been in business since 1998, and in that time we have accomplished a thorough understanding of the roofing industry and the solutions that will work for your home. Given our experience we offer full Roofing and Siding Installs, Emergency Roof Repairs, Gutter Installs/Replacements, and Commercial Roofing Installs/Repairs.

Our Work

1848 Grant Avenue , Franklin, NJ, US
  • CertainTeed Siding
  • CertainTeed Siding: Sterling Gray
21 North 4th Street , Pleasantville, NJ, US
    12 Aristone Drive , Berlin, NJ, US
    • CertainTeed Siding
    • CertainTeed Siding: Sterling Gray
    1507 Haddonfield-Berlin Road , Cherry Hill, NJ, US
    • CertainTeed Siding
    • CertainTeed Siding: Sterling Gray
    4917 Ventnor Avenue , Ventnor City, NJ, US
    • CertainTeed Siding
    • CertainTeed Siding: Sterling Gray

    Customer Testimonials

    Reviewer photo
    Michelle Santoli
    ECC recently completed a full replacement of my house siding in Gloucester City. Everything was great from the start. They were detailed oriented, made sure we got exactly what we wanted, and worked quickly. They answered all our never ending questions without any issues. I would highly recommend for the quality, price, and professionalism. I plan to use them again for my roof updates next year.
    Reviewer photo
    Kate King
    Professional from start to finish! Easy financing options if needed. Very knowledgeable and thorough. Tom and Dom were the best. Very happy and 100% would recommend for all your roofing and gutter needs.
    Reviewer photo
    Lea Hernandez
    ECC Roofing was exceptional from initial point of contact to the completion of installation of roof. From initial consultation, to the completion of the work all staff were professional and responsive.
    Reviewer photo
    Roger Muessig
    Professional from first contact to completion of job. I wouldn’t hesitate to use their services again or recommend them to someone else.
    Reviewer photo
    Jeffrey Duble
    ECC did a great job on my roof, soffit & fascia,old house that looks brand new again!!